Sets and subsets
If you have many sets, then you can categorize them into subsets. This reduces the size of the list in the Lookup dialog. The period “.”
is the punctuation mark that is used to separate the set code and the subset.
For example, regulation items (FDA
, CTFA
, USDA
) can be prefixed by REG.
:
REG.FDA
REG.USDA
Packaged goods sets (cans, lids, bottles, labels) can be prefixed by PKG.
:
PKG.LIDS
PKG.CANS
